Oregon recorded 7,860 confirmed or presumed coronavirus infections for the week ending Sunday, Jan. 17, down 4% from the previous week. The decline isn’t a mirage: Testing volume grew but total cases, and the percentage of positive cases, fell. The decline is even more pronounced for the current week which, although not complete, it on track to have the fewest cases since October.
